low saturated fats, low simple carbohydrates, daily exercise. eat breakfast every day, drink plenty of water, don't eat after dinnertime. eat plenty of vegetables that grow above the ground (so few potatoes--emphasize the green leafy veggies). i've tried a hundred diets and this is the only way i've been successful--have kept off 80lb for more than 10 years. fast weight loss never results in lasting results--take your time, do it right and you'll be happy with the results. also, weigh yourself daily--i think the constant feedback is essential in self-monitoring. check out the national weight control registry http://www.nwcr.ws/ for tips common to long-term weight losers. good luck to you!

You could conceivably lose 30 pounds in 3 to 6 months. Considering that you probably took more than 6 months to put ON the 30 pounds, this would be fast.

You don't want to hear this, but the answer is Eat Right, and Exercise. This is the only method proven to work. Sorry that you don't want to hear this, but tough. Start with a well-balanced, calorie restricted diet. Look at eating whole grains, fruits, vegetables, lean meat, and low-fat dairy. Now, keep this within a reduced range, probably around 1500 calories a day (definately more than 1200 to prevent starvation mode). To see better results, you need to exercise too. Work on trying to exercise 30 minutes, 3 times a week. Don't worry on intensity - work on the habit. Once you are adjusted to this, you can gradually build up your workouts.

There is a fundamental problem to your question. You are focusing on the weight, not on how the weight got there. Unless you address the unhealthy habits that caused you to gain weight in the first place, you will never find a permanant solution to your weight problem. Fix the unhealthy habits, change them into healthy habits, and you will never have this problem again.

I lost 105 pounds in 6 months. Here is how I did it.
1. Every morning get up and walk for 45 minutes. You can start with less time, but you want to get up to 45 minutes, and it must be fast walk. You want your heart rate to go up. It must be in the morning, it kick starts your metabolism.
2. I cut out Red Meat, and fatty foods. Boneless skinnless chicken breast, baked, or grilled, rice and vegetables (steamed).
3. Eat half. Just eat half of what you normally eat. Put 1/2 on your plate, and put the rest away. Cook less. When you go to fast food, get salads only. Or grilled chicken. No fries, only diet soda. Or water.

It will work, once you get into a routine, you will get hooked on the results, and you will keep the routine. It has been over a year for me.

Also start counting your calories. Write them down. You would be amazed as to how much more aware you are of your caloric intake, if you actually write it down.
